From today’s reading...

‘Then the kingdom of Heaven will be like this: Ten wedding attendants took their lamps and went to meet the bridegroom. Five of them were foolish and five were sensible:’” Matthew 25:1-2

In less-refined words, you can’t save every puppy in the pound.

It’s better to provide 100% care and support to 10 people/puppies than 10% support to 100.

All ten wedding attendants had the money and the time and the encouragement to bring ample oil for their lamps, but only five did.

The five foolish ones were allowed to suffer the consequences of their choices.

The same is true for you and me. You’ve been instructed on how to think, act, and pray. Now you get to choose to listen and heed that advice or not.

I hope you choose to...

Stay the course.
Keep the faith.
Endure.
